Bug 217517

Summary: akregator crash khtml Qt::WA_InputMethodEnabled
Product: [Applications] akregator Reporter: Marcin Gryszkalis <mg>
Component: generalAssignee: kdepim bugs <kdepim-bugs>
Status: RESOLVED DUPLICATE    
Severity: crash CC: m1k0
Priority: NOR    
Version: unspecified   
Target Milestone: ---   
Platform: Unlisted Binaries   
OS: Linux   
Latest Commit: Version Fixed In:
Sentry Crash Report:
Attachments: New crash information added by DrKonqi

Description Marcin Gryszkalis 2009-12-06 00:38:15 UTC
Application that crashed: akregator
Version of the application: 1.5.3
KDE Version: 4.3.4 (KDE 4.3.4)
Qt Version: 4.6.0
Operating System: Linux 2.6.31-gentoo-r5-ines i686

What I was doing when the application crashed:
Akregator crashes where on one of pages (page contains youtube embedded video)
http://www.santyago.pl/rss.xml
http://www.santyago.pl/blog/read/mam-talent-na-ukrainie.html
Konqueror opens the page without any problem.



 -- Backtrace:
Application: Akregator (akregator), signal: Aborted
[KCrash Handler]
#6  0xffffe424 in __kernel_vsyscall ()
#7  0xb465d421 in *__GI_raise (sig=6) at ../nptl/sysdeps/unix/sysv/linux/raise.c:64
#8  0xb465eb62 in *__GI_abort () at abort.c:92
#9  0xb54aa9f0 in qt_message_output (msgType=QtFatalMsg, buf=0xcc264e8 "ASSERT: \"!widget || widget->testAttribute(Qt::WA_InputMethodEnabled)\" in file inputmethod/qinputcontext.cpp, line 188")
    at global/qglobal.cpp:2226
#10 0xb54aab88 in qt_message (msgType=<value optimized out>, msg=0xb56226a8 "ASSERT: \"%s\" in file %s, line %d", ap=0xbfefffe4 " \247\023\265") at global/qglobal.cpp:2272
#11 0xb54aac84 in qFatal (msg=0xb56226a8 "ASSERT: \"%s\" in file %s, line %d") at global/qglobal.cpp:2455
#12 0xb54aafdd in qt_assert (assertion=0xb513a720 "!widget || widget->testAttribute(Qt::WA_InputMethodEnabled)", file=0xb513a700 "inputmethod/qinputcontext.cpp", line=188) at global/qglobal.cpp:1989
#13 0xb4ff9374 in QInputContext::setFocusWidget (this=0x8fdea58, widget=0x9001560) at inputmethod/qinputcontext.cpp:188
#14 0xb4ffacc0 in QXIMInputContext::setFocusWidget (this=0x8fdea58, w=0x9001560) at inputmethod/qximinputcontext_x11.cpp:613
#15 0xb4a44af5 in QWidget::setAttribute (this=0x8fd8378, attribute=Qt::WA_NativeWindow, on=true) at kernel/qwidget.cpp:10364
#16 0xb4a52f76 in QWidgetPrivate::enforceNativeChildren (this=0x8fd98a0) at src/gui/kernel/qwidget_p.h:530
#17 0xb4a45017 in QWidget::setAttribute (this=0x8fde580, attribute=Qt::WA_NativeWindow, on=true) at kernel/qwidget.cpp:10360
#18 0xb4a44973 in QWidgetPrivate::createWinId (this=0x900bb68, winid=0) at kernel/qwidget.cpp:2280
#19 0xb4a451f7 in QWidget::setAttribute (this=0x900bb50, attribute=Qt::WA_NativeWindow, on=true) at kernel/qwidget.cpp:10362
#20 0xb4a44973 in QWidgetPrivate::createWinId (this=0x900c0f0, winid=0) at kernel/qwidget.cpp:2280
#21 0xb4a451f7 in QWidget::setAttribute (this=0x900bca8, attribute=Qt::WA_NativeWindow, on=true) at kernel/qwidget.cpp:10362
#22 0xb4a52f76 in QWidgetPrivate::enforceNativeChildren (this=0x900bb68) at src/gui/kernel/qwidget_p.h:530
#23 0xb4a45017 in QWidget::setAttribute (this=0x9001560, attribute=Qt::WA_NativeWindow, on=true) at kernel/qwidget.cpp:10360
#24 0xb4a44973 in QWidgetPrivate::createWinId (this=0x9001af8, winid=0) at kernel/qwidget.cpp:2280
#25 0xb4a451f7 in QWidget::setAttribute (this=0x9001410, attribute=Qt::WA_NativeWindow, on=true) at kernel/qwidget.cpp:10362
#26 0xb4a52f76 in QWidgetPrivate::enforceNativeChildren (this=0x9001598) at src/gui/kernel/qwidget_p.h:530
#27 0xb4a45017 in QWidget::setAttribute (this=0x9001830, attribute=Qt::WA_NativeWindow, on=true) at kernel/qwidget.cpp:10360
#28 0xb4a44973 in QWidgetPrivate::createWinId (this=0x9006e58, winid=0) at kernel/qwidget.cpp:2280
#29 0xb4a451f7 in QWidget::setAttribute (this=0x9006ac0, attribute=Qt::WA_NativeWindow, on=true) at kernel/qwidget.cpp:10362
#30 0xb4a52f76 in QWidgetPrivate::enforceNativeChildren (this=0x9001848) at src/gui/kernel/qwidget_p.h:530
#31 0xb4a45017 in QWidget::setAttribute (this=0xafc5248, attribute=Qt::WA_NativeWindow, on=true) at kernel/qwidget.cpp:10360
#32 0xb4a44973 in QWidgetPrivate::createWinId (this=0xc724440, winid=0) at kernel/qwidget.cpp:2280
#33 0xb4a451f7 in QWidget::setAttribute (this=0x913c000, attribute=Qt::WA_NativeWindow, on=true) at kernel/qwidget.cpp:10362
#34 0xb4a96217 in QX11EmbedContainer (this=0x913c000, parent=0xafc5248) at kernel/qx11embed_x11.cpp:1058
#35 0xaf2c25b4 in NSPluginInstance (this=0x913c000, parent=0xafc5248, viewerDBusId=..., id=..., baseUrl=...) at /usr/src/debug/kde-base/nsplugins-4.3.4/nsplugins-4.3.4/nsplugins/nspluginloader.cpp:64
#36 0xaf2c3569 in NSPluginLoader::newInstance (this=0xafd8818, parent=0xafc5248, url=..., mimeType=..., embed=true, _argn=..., _argv=..., ownDBusId=..., callbackId=..., reload=<value optimized out>)
    at /usr/src/debug/kde-base/nsplugins-4.3.4/nsplugins-4.3.4/nsplugins/nspluginloader.cpp:488
#37 0xaf2bcee3 in PluginPart::openUrl (this=0xcbd02e0, url=...) at /usr/src/debug/kde-base/nsplugins-4.3.4/nsplugins-4.3.4/nsplugins/plugin_part.cpp:266
#38 0xb6269c6e in KHTMLPart::processObjectRequest (this=0x8fd84e0, child=0x921f810, _url=..., mimetype=...) at /usr/src/debug/kde-base/kdelibs-4.3.4/kdelibs-4.3.4/khtml/khtml_part.cpp:4506
#39 0xb626ac1b in KHTMLPart::requestObject (this=0x8fd84e0, child=0x921f810, url=..., _args=..., browserArgs=...) at /usr/src/debug/kde-base/kdelibs-4.3.4/kdelibs-4.3.4/khtml/khtml_part.cpp:4257
#40 0xb626b457 in KHTMLPart::requestObject (this=0x8fd84e0, frame=0xb7dc230, url=..., serviceType=..., params=...) at /usr/src/debug/kde-base/kdelibs-4.3.4/kdelibs-4.3.4/khtml/khtml_part.cpp:4185
#41 0xb6340939 in DOM::HTMLObjectBaseElementImpl::computeContent (this=0xb7dc230) at /usr/src/debug/kde-base/kdelibs-4.3.4/kdelibs-4.3.4/khtml/html/html_objectimpl.cpp:519
#42 0xb633cbed in DOM::HTMLPartContainerElementImpl::computeContentIfNeeded (this=0x0) at /usr/src/debug/kde-base/kdelibs-4.3.4/kdelibs-4.3.4/khtml/html/html_objectimpl.cpp:90
#43 0xb630196f in khtml::KHTMLParser::popOneBlock (this=0xaf0e550, delBlock=true) at /usr/src/debug/kde-base/kdelibs-4.3.4/kdelibs-4.3.4/khtml/html/htmlparser.cpp:1863
#44 0xb63026cc in khtml::KHTMLParser::popBlock (this=0xaf0e550, _id=72) at /usr/src/debug/kde-base/kdelibs-4.3.4/kdelibs-4.3.4/khtml/html/htmlparser.cpp:1804
#45 0xb6305013 in khtml::KHTMLParser::parseToken (this=0xaf0e550, t=0xc835d9c) at /usr/src/debug/kde-base/kdelibs-4.3.4/kdelibs-4.3.4/khtml/html/htmlparser.cpp:254
#46 0xb630643b in khtml::HTMLTokenizer::processToken (this=0xc835d88) at /usr/src/debug/kde-base/kdelibs-4.3.4/kdelibs-4.3.4/khtml/html/htmltokenizer.cpp:2056
#47 0xb630a850 in khtml::HTMLTokenizer::parseTag (this=0xc835d88, src=...) at /usr/src/debug/kde-base/kdelibs-4.3.4/kdelibs-4.3.4/khtml/html/htmltokenizer.cpp:1529
#48 0xb630cf1b in khtml::HTMLTokenizer::write (this=0xc835d88, str=..., appendData=true) at /usr/src/debug/kde-base/kdelibs-4.3.4/kdelibs-4.3.4/khtml/html/htmltokenizer.cpp:1810
#49 0xb626bc99 in KHTMLPart::write (this=0x8fd84e0, 
    data=0xc936f68 ">@olson: napisal 'taki' filmik, nie 'ten' filmik - artysci rysujacy w piasku od dawna tworza swoje prace, ona nie jest ani pierwsza, ani najlepsza, cho ... </a></small>\n", '\t' <repeats 12 times>, "</li>\n\t\t\t\t\t\t\t\t\t<li "..., len=6638) at /usr/src/debug/kde-base/kdelibs-4.3.4/kdelibs-4.3.4/khtml/khtml_part.cpp:2104
#50 0xb626e130 in KHTMLPart::slotData (this=0x8fd84e0, kio_job=0x8e356b8, data=...) at /usr/src/debug/kde-base/kdelibs-4.3.4/kdelibs-4.3.4/khtml/khtml_part.cpp:1786
#51 0xb6275ec3 in KHTMLPart::qt_metacall (this=0x8fd84e0, _c=QMetaObject::InvokeMetaMethod, _id=19, _a=0xbff016d4)
    at /usr/src/debug/kde-base/kdelibs-4.3.4/kdelibs-4.3.4_build/khtml/khtml_part.moc:277
#52 0xb1f10f63 in Akregator::ArticleViewerPart::qt_metacall (this=0x8fd84e0, _c=QMetaObject::InvokeMetaMethod, _id=33, _a=0xbff016d4)
    at /usr/src/debug/kde-base/akregator-4.3.4/akregator-4.3.4_build/akregator/src/articleviewer.moc:238
#53 0xb55bdc83 in QMetaObject::metacall (object=0x8fd84e0, cl=QMetaObject::InvokeMetaMethod, idx=33, argv=0xbff016d4) at kernel/qmetaobject.cpp:237
#54 0xb55cc4cd in QMetaObject::activate (sender=0x8e356b8, m=0xb605c2d0, local_signal_index=0, argv=0x0) at kernel/qobject.cpp:3286
#55 0xb5e7b136 in KIO::TransferJob::data (this=0x8e356b8, _t1=0x8e356b8, _t2=...) at /usr/src/debug/kde-base/kdelibs-4.3.4/kdelibs-4.3.4_build/kio/jobclasses.moc:388
#56 0xb5e7bca4 in KIO::TransferJob::slotData (this=0x8e356b8, _data=...) at /usr/src/debug/kde-base/kdelibs-4.3.4/kdelibs-4.3.4/kio/kio/job.cpp:903
#57 0xb5e85c85 in KIO::TransferJob::qt_metacall (this=0x8e356b8, _c=QMetaObject::InvokeMetaMethod, _id=8, _a=0xbff01848)
    at /usr/src/debug/kde-base/kdelibs-4.3.4/kdelibs-4.3.4_build/kio/jobclasses.moc:368
#58 0xb55bdc83 in QMetaObject::metacall (object=0x8e356b8, cl=QMetaObject::InvokeMetaMethod, idx=48, argv=0xbff01848) at kernel/qmetaobject.cpp:237
#59 0xb55cc4cd in QMetaObject::activate (sender=0xcbd12b8, m=0xb605eee4, local_signal_index=0, argv=0x0) at kernel/qobject.cpp:3286
#60 0xb5f2b9f2 in KIO::SlaveInterface::data (this=0xcbd12b8, _t1=...) at /usr/src/debug/kde-base/kdelibs-4.3.4/kdelibs-4.3.4_build/kio/slaveinterface.moc:146
#61 0xb5f2dcdb in KIO::SlaveInterface::dispatch (this=0xcbd12b8, _cmd=100, rawdata=...) at /usr/src/debug/kde-base/kdelibs-4.3.4/kdelibs-4.3.4/kio/kio/slaveinterface.cpp:163
#62 0xb5f2dfc0 in KIO::SlaveInterface::dispatch (this=0xcbd12b8) at /usr/src/debug/kde-base/kdelibs-4.3.4/kdelibs-4.3.4/kio/kio/slaveinterface.cpp:91
#63 0xb5f220fe in KIO::Slave::gotInput (this=0xcbd12b8) at /usr/src/debug/kde-base/kdelibs-4.3.4/kdelibs-4.3.4/kio/kio/slave.cpp:322
#64 0xb5f2351e in KIO::Slave::qt_metacall (this=0xcbd12b8, _c=QMetaObject::InvokeMetaMethod, _id=30, _a=0xbff01b4c) at /usr/src/debug/kde-base/kdelibs-4.3.4/kdelibs-4.3.4_build/kio/slave.moc:82
#65 0xb55bdc83 in QMetaObject::metacall (object=0xcbd12b8, cl=QMetaObject::InvokeMetaMethod, idx=30, argv=0xbff01b4c) at kernel/qmetaobject.cpp:237
#66 0xb55cc4cd in QMetaObject::activate (sender=0xaf31158, m=0xb605b820, local_signal_index=0, argv=0x0) at kernel/qobject.cpp:3286
#67 0xb5e5118c in KIO::Connection::readyRead (this=0xaf31158) at /usr/src/debug/kde-base/kdelibs-4.3.4/kdelibs-4.3.4_build/kio/connection.moc:92
#68 0xb5e51fae in KIO::ConnectionPrivate::dequeue (this=0xaf379b0) at /usr/src/debug/kde-base/kdelibs-4.3.4/kdelibs-4.3.4/kio/kio/connection.cpp:82
#69 0xb5e52d71 in KIO::Connection::qt_metacall (this=0xaf31158, _c=QMetaObject::InvokeMetaMethod, _id=5, _a=0xb057978)
    at /usr/src/debug/kde-base/kdelibs-4.3.4/kdelibs-4.3.4_build/kio/connection.moc:79
#70 0xb55bdc83 in QMetaObject::metacall (object=0xaf31158, cl=QMetaObject::InvokeMetaMethod, idx=5, argv=0xb057978) at kernel/qmetaobject.cpp:237
#71 0xb55c78b9 in QMetaCallEvent::placeMetaCall (this=0xc633668, object=0xaf31158) at kernel/qobject.cpp:574
#72 0xb55c8680 in QObject::event (this=0xaf31158, e=0xc633668) at kernel/qobject.cpp:1252
#73 0xb49eeee9 in QApplicationPrivate::notify_helper (this=0x8d93700, receiver=0xaf31158, e=0xc633668) at kernel/qapplication.cpp:4242
#74 0xb49f7346 in QApplication::notify (this=0xbff02418, receiver=0xaf31158, e=0xc633668) at kernel/qapplication.cpp:4207
#75 0xb5b91585 in KApplication::notify (this=0xbff02418, receiver=0xaf31158, event=0xc633668) at /usr/src/debug/kde-base/kdelibs-4.3.4/kdelibs-4.3.4/kdeui/kernel/kapplication.cpp:302
#76 0xb55b73eb in QCoreApplication::notifyInternal (this=0xbff02418, receiver=0xaf31158, event=0xc633668) at kernel/qcoreapplication.cpp:704
#77 0xb55b828c in QCoreApplication::sendEvent (receiver=0x0, event_type=0, data=0x8d72f58) at kernel/qcoreapplication.h:215
#78 QCoreApplicationPrivate::sendPostedEvents (receiver=0x0, event_type=0, data=0x8d72f58) at kernel/qcoreapplication.cpp:1345
#79 0xb55b8510 in QCoreApplication::sendPostedEvents (receiver=0x0, event_type=0) at kernel/qcoreapplication.cpp:1238
#80 0xb55e466b in QCoreApplication::sendPostedEvents (s=0x8d9cf10) at kernel/qcoreapplication.h:220
#81 postEventSourceDispatch (s=0x8d9cf10) at kernel/qeventdispatcher_glib.cpp:276
#82 0xb3c3ba0e in g_main_dispatch (context=0x8d9ce90) at gmain.c:1960
#83 IA__g_main_context_dispatch (context=0x8d9ce90) at gmain.c:2513
#84 0xb3c3ede1 in g_main_context_iterate (context=0x8d9ce90, block=1, dispatch=1, self=0x8d90a88) at gmain.c:2591
#85 0xb3c3ef42 in IA__g_main_context_iteration (context=0x8d9ce90, may_block=1) at gmain.c:2654
#86 0xb55e4276 in QEventDispatcherGlib::processEvents (this=0x8d72ae0, flags=...) at kernel/qeventdispatcher_glib.cpp:407
#87 0xb4a9ce20 in QGuiEventDispatcherGlib::processEvents (this=0x8d72ae0, flags=...) at kernel/qguieventdispatcher_glib.cpp:202
#88 0xb55b5a7f in QEventLoop::processEvents (this=0xbff02394, flags=) at kernel/qeventloop.cpp:149
#89 0xb55b5e89 in QEventLoop::exec (this=0xbff02394, flags=...) at kernel/qeventloop.cpp:201
#90 0xb55b85b8 in QCoreApplication::exec () at kernel/qcoreapplication.cpp:981
#91 0xb49edc62 in QApplication::exec () at kernel/qapplication.cpp:3570
#92 0x0804fed0 in main (argc=5, argv=0xbff02534) at /usr/src/debug/kde-base/akregator-4.3.4/akregator-4.3.4/akregator/src/main.cpp:103

Reported using DrKonqi
Comment 1 Christophe Marin 2009-12-06 15:16:58 UTC
>KDE Version: 4.3.4 (KDE 4.3.4)
>Qt Version: 4.6.0

Was KDE built with this Qt version ?
Comment 2 Christophe Marin 2009-12-06 15:24:10 UTC

*** This bug has been marked as a duplicate of bug 216878 ***
Comment 3 Michał Kudła 2010-01-08 22:47:56 UTC
Created attachment 39701 [details]
New crash information added by DrKonqi

crash during openning a new rss channel